Bonjour.
J'ai développé une application utilisée pour la gestion de visites médicales en milieu scolaire. Le projet VBA est protégé par mot de passe pour éviter que les utilisateurs ne se retrouvent dans le code suite à un message d'erreur imprévu et non géré et permettant d'ouvrir le code pour déboggage.
Je voudrais par le code renommer des formulaires pour permettre aux utilisateurs de travailler de deux manières différentes.
Voici le code :
Ceci fonctionne parfaitement si j'ai auparavant introduit le mdp VBA, ou si je supprime le mdp, mais si ce n'est pas le cas, j'ai le message d'erreur 2017 qui me demande d'introduire le mdp dans VBA avant de renommer les formulaires.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 Private Sub Format_jma_Click() DoCmd.Rename "Vaccinations_2", acForm, "Vaccinations" DoCmd.Rename "Vaccinations", acForm, "Vaccinations_1" DoCmd.Rename "Vaccinations_1", acForm, "Vaccinations_2" End Sub
Y a-t-il un moyen d'envoyer le mdp par le code avant de lancer les commandes de renommage? Merci d'avance pour les éventuelles solution(s).
Partager